From: Luis R. Rodriguez Date: Mon, 2 Nov 2009 17:15:15 +0000 (-0500) Subject: wl1271: use __dev_alloc_skb() on RX X-Git-Tag: v2.6.33-rc1~388^2~449^2~51 X-Git-Url: https://openfabrics.org/gitweb/?a=commitdiff_plain;h=e9a6269d5bcb1c7cd18cea02a9a73fac8712f2d1;p=~shefty%2Frdma-dev.git wl1271: use __dev_alloc_skb() on RX RX is handled in a workqueue therefore allocating for GFP_ATOMIC is overkill and not required. Signed-off-by: Luis R. Rodriguez Acked-by: Luciano Coelho Signed-off-by: John W. Linville --- diff --git a/drivers/net/wireless/wl12xx/wl1271_rx.c b/drivers/net/wireless/wl12xx/wl1271_rx.c index 37d81ab6acc..ca645f38109 100644 --- a/drivers/net/wireless/wl12xx/wl1271_rx.c +++ b/drivers/net/wireless/wl12xx/wl1271_rx.c @@ -159,7 +159,7 @@ static void wl1271_rx_handle_data(struct wl1271 *wl, u32 length) u8 *buf; u8 beacon = 0; - skb = dev_alloc_skb(length); + skb = __dev_alloc_skb(length, GFP_KERNEL); if (!skb) { wl1271_error("Couldn't allocate RX frame"); return;